Courses Taught:

BUS 1125

Financial Accounting

Covers financial accounting concepts from a "user" perspective and focuses on the application of these concepts in real-world environments.  The central theme will concentrate on how economic information is identified, measured, and communicated.  Topics include accounting as a form of communication, financial statement analysis and the annual report, processing accounting information, income measurement and accrual accounting, merchandise accounting and internal control, accounting for assets, liabilities, and owners' equity. 
 
BUS 2126

 

Managerial Accounting

This course focuses on strategic decision-making related to cost analysis and cost management.  Topics include cost-volume-profit analysis, activity-based costing and activity-based management, how costs behave, relevant information, pricing cost management, quality, time, theory of constraints, and performance measurement. 
 
BUS 2226 Accounting Internship and Seminar

Students earn credits for supervised work experience in accounting positions.  They attend seminars and complete projects related to their internship.
